When you are considering buying a home in the South Beach

you are going to want to do some research to find out what the average price is for homes. One of the easiest ways to do that is to compare the average price per square foot of the different properties. Here are some of the most popular properties in the area as well as the average price per square foot. They are in order from highest to lowest. All of the data is from units sold in 2010.

Ten units were recently sold at The Setai Miami Beach

The Setai condos sold for an average of $1,517.28 per square foot. Apogee Miami Beach, another popular property, sold nine units. The average price per square foot at this property was $1,317.74. Twelve units sold at Continuum North for $1,053.44, and four units sold at Il Villaggio Miami Beach for $859.08 per square foot.

Continuum South

had sixteen properties sell with an average square foot price of $769.49. Murano at Portofino had four sold properties at $730.21 per square foot. Mosaic sold five units at $631.59 per square foot, while Murano Grande had eleven properties sell at $556.68.

Seventeen properties sold at ICON South Beach

for $543.99, while Blue Diamond Miami Beach sold twelve units for $470.51 per square foot. The Yacht Club sold sixteen properties at $443.40, and at Bentley Bay, nine condos sold for $412.74 per square foot.

Cosmopolitan South Beach

sold eleven units for $384.58, and Sunset Harbor had fourteen units sell at $346.17 per square foot. Roney Palace had an amazing thirty units sell for $341.87 per square foot, the Floridian had twenty-five condos sell at $317.81 per square foot. Rounding out the list is Wavery, which had eighteen units sell at $307.04 per square foot.

As you can see, there are many different types of properties available in the area, and people with large and small budgets alike should be able to find a great home in South Beach.

Cosmopolitan South Beach

Terms like charming, unique and singular

have all been used to describe the various homes available at the Cosmopolitan South Beach. From delightful “pied a terre” arrangements to three bedroom homes, the Cosmopolitan condo provides a private and stylish residence in the Mediterranean design. Because it takes up an enormous swath of the South of Fifth (SoFi) district, the Cosmopolitan Miami will eventually provide more than twenty-four different structures and approximately twelve hundred homes.

The main building

offers an enormous and incredibly welcoming lobby that is the product of an award-winning design team. Each of the homes supplies the owner, and any guests, with secured parking. The building is staffed with round the clock security, parking attendants and even concierge services. In addition to excellent services, however, the Cosmopolitan Condo Miami also offers a private courtyard pool and lounge with waterfalls and professional landscaping. This leads to the fitness center with the most modern equipment offerings.

Though the floor plans

and varieties of the homes vary quite dramatically, each and every one will offer a balcony or terrace, floor to ceiling windows, gourmet kitchens all outfitted with top of the line, stainless steel appliances, granite countertops and luxury fixtures as well as under counter lighting. Each of the homes comes with an appropriately sized washer and dryer and all of the baths are outfitted with Italian tile and high tech fixtures, including whirlpool tubs and glass shower stalls.

Clearly the design team

of this South Beach condo structure is aiming to meet the needs of the diverse South Beach real estate population. There are also uber-luxurious homes available in the Cosmopolitan Courts that are part of the structure, and it is here that residents can opt for the largest floor plans possible.

The Cosmopolitan South Beach Condo

is within walking distance from every imaginable South Beach destination, and still provides residents and visitors alike with an oasis of quiet charm and elegance.
